Freigeben über


IBaseRunContext-Schnittstelle

Stellt eine Schnittstelle bereit, die vom Testadapter für die Kommunikation mit dem Testausführungsframework verwendet wird.

Namespace:  Microsoft.VisualStudio.TestTools.Execution
Assembly:  Microsoft.VisualStudio.QualityTools.ExecutionCommon (in Microsoft.VisualStudio.QualityTools.ExecutionCommon.dll)

Syntax

'Declaration
Public Interface IBaseRunContext
public interface IBaseRunContext
public interface class IBaseRunContext
type IBaseRunContext =  interface end
public interface IBaseRunContext

Der IBaseRunContext-Typ macht die folgenden Member verfügbar.

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ft ResultSink Ruft ein Objekt ab, das zum Senden der Testergebnisse an das Testausführungsframework verwendet wird.
Öffentliche Eigenschaft RunConfig Ruft Informationen über den Testlauf ab.
Öffentliche Eigenschaft TestRunner Stellt eine Schnittstelle bereit, mit der der Testadapter einen oder mehrere innere Tests ausführt.

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ode PauseTestRun Sendet eine Anforderung, um den Testlauf anzuhalten.
Öffentliche Methode StopTestRun Sendet eine Anforderung, um den Testlauf zu beenden.

Zum Seitenanfang

Siehe auch

Referenz

Microsoft.VisualStudio.TestTools.Execution-Namespace